Sawtooth-Control Mechanism using Toroidally Propagating Ion-Cyclotron-ResonanceWaves in Tokamaks
The sawtooth control mechanism in plasmas employing off-axis toroidally propagating ion cyclotron resonance waves in tokamaks is reinvestigated. The radial drift excursion of energetic passing ions distributed asymmetrically in the velocity parallel to the magnetic field determines stability when the rational q = 1 surface resides within a narrow region centered about the shifted fundamental cyclotron resonance.
